How they compare

Zambia currently reports 77.55 % against 74.58 % in Myanmar, a difference of 2.97 %.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 34 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Myanmar ahead.

Myanmar ranks 24th and Zambia ranks 21st of 209 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Myanmar averaged higher in 2 and Zambia in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ade Myanmar Zambia Difference Ahead
1990s 91.86 % 86.96 % 4.9 % Myanmar
2000s 88.92 % 86.36 % 2.56 % Myanmar
2010s 83.69 % 85.46 % 1.77 % Zambia
2020s 75.65 % 78.91 % 3.26 % Zambia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ions indicators disseminates indicators on sectoral shares of total national gre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ions as well as three indicators of emissions intensity: per capita emissions; emissions per value of agricultural production; and emissions per area of agricultural land.
